|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Moves the configs_for and DatabaseConfig struct into it's own file. I was considering doing this in a future refactoring but our set up forced me to move it now. You see there are `mattr_accessor`'s on the Core module that have default settings. For example the `schema_format` defaults to Ruby. So if I call `configs_for` or any methods in the Core module it will reset the `schema_format` to `:ruby`. By moving it to it's own class we can keep the logic contained and avoid this unfortunate issue. The second change here does a double loop over the yaml files. Bear with me... Our tests dictate that we need to load an environment before our rake tasks because we could have something in an environment that the database.yml depends on. There are side-effects to this and I think there's a deeper bug that needs to be fixed but that's for another issue. The gist of the problem is when I was creating the dynamic rake tasks if the yaml that that rake task is calling evaluates code (like erb) that calls the environment configs the code will blow up because the environment is not loaded yet. To avoid this issue we added a new method that simply loads the yaml and does not evaluate the erb or anything in it. We then use that yaml to create the task name. Inside the task name we can then call `load_config` and load the real config to actually call the code internal to the task. I admit, this is gross, but refactoring can't all be pretty all the time and I'm working hard with `@tenderlove` to refactor much more of this code to get to a better place re connection management and rake tasks.

* Update schema/structure dump tasks for multi dbeileencodes2018-03-212-14/+36
| | | | | | | Adds the ability to dump the schema or structure files for mulitple databases. Loops through the configs for a given env and sets a filename based on the format, then establishes a connection for that config and dumps into the file.
* Add ability to create/drop/migrate all dbs for a given enveileencodes2018-03-212-8/+11
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| `each_current_configuration` is used by create, drop, and other methods to find the configs for a given environment and returning those to the method calling them. The change here allows for the database commands to operate on all the configs in the environment. Previously we couldn't slice the hashes and iterate over them becasue they could be two tier or could be three tier. By using the database config structs we don't need to care whether we're dealing with a three tier or two tier, we can just parse all the configs based on the environment. This makes it possible for us to run `bin/rails db:create` and it will create all the configs for the dev and test environment ust like it does for a two tier - it creates the db for dev and test. Now `db:create` will create `primary` for dev and test, and `animals` for dev and test if our database.yml looks like: ``` development: primary: etc animals: etc test: primary: etc animals: etc ``` This means that `bin/rails db:create`, `bin/rails db:drop`, and `bin/rails db:migrate` will operate on the dev and test env for both primary and animals ds.
* Add create/drop/migrate db tasks for each database in the environmenteileencodes2018-03-211-0/+25
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| If we have a three-tier yaml file like this: ``` development: primary: database: "development" animals: database: "development_animals" migrations_paths: "db/animals_migrate" ``` This will add db create/drop/and migrate tasks for each level of the config under that environment. ``` bin/rails db:drop:primary bin/rails db:drop:animals bin/rails db:create:primary bin/rails db:create:animals bin/rails db:migrate:primary bin/rails db:migrate:animals ```
* Add DatabaseConfig Struct and associated methodseileencodes2018-03-211-0/+39
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Passing around and parsing hashes is easy if you know that it's a two tier config and each key will be named after the environment and each value will be the config for that environment key. This falls apart pretty quickly with three-tier configs. We have no idea what the second tier will be named (we know the first is primary but we don't know the second), we have no easy way of figuring out how deep a hash we have without iterating over it, and we'd have to do this a lot throughout the code since it breaks all of Active Record's assumptions regarding configurations. These methods allow us to pass around objects instead. This will allow us to more easily parse the configs for the rake tasks. Evenually I'd like to replace the Active Record connection management that passes around config hashes to use these methods as well but that's much farther down the road. `walk_configs` takes an environment, specification name, and a config and turns them into DatabaseConfig struct objects so we can ask the configs questions like: ``` db_config.spec_name => animals db_config.env_name => development db_config.config { :adapter => mysql etc } ``` `db_configs` loops through all given configurations and returns an array of DatabaseConfig structs for each config in the yaml file. and lastly `configs_for` takes an environment and either returns the spec name and config if a block is given or returns an array of DatabaseConfig structs just for the given environment.

| * | Memoize the result of gsubbing @virtual_pathDillon Welch2018-03-201-2/+5
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| This gets called many times for each virtual_path, creating a new string each time that `translate` is called. We can memoize this so that it only happens once per virtual_path instead.

| * | | Interpolate '' instead of nil when multiple is false.Dillon Welch2018-03-201-3/+3
| |/ / |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| "my string #{nil}" results in an additional '' string allocation, I'm guessing because the nil has to be converted to a string. "my string #{'[]' if multiple}" results in "my string #{nil}" if multiple is false. Doing "my string #{''}" does not result in an extra string allocation. I moved the if multiple logic into a method so I only had to make the change once. ```ruby begin require "bundler/inline" rescue LoadError => e $stderr.puts "Bundler version 1.10 or later is required. Please update your Bundler" raise e end gemfile(true) do source "https://rubygems.org" gem "benchmark-ips" gem "rails" end def allocate_count GC.disable before = ObjectSpace.count_objects yield after = ObjectSpace.count_objects after.each { |k,v| after[k] = v - before[k] } after[:T_HASH] -= 1 # probe effect - we created the before hash. GC.enable result = after.reject { |k,v| v == 0 } GC.start result end @html_options = {} def master_version(multiple=nil) "hi#{"[]" if multiple}" end def fast_version(multiple=nil) str = multiple ? "[]" : '' "hi#{str}" end def test puts "master_version" puts allocate_count { 1000.times { master_version } } puts "master_version with arg" puts allocate_count { 1000.times { master_version(' there') } } puts "fast_version" puts allocate_count { 1000.times { fast_version } } puts "fast_version with arg" puts allocate_count { 1000.times { fast_version(' there') } } Benchmark.ips do |x| x.report("master_version") { master_version } x.report("master_version with arg") { master_version(' there') } x.report("fast_version") { fast_version } x.report("fast_version with arg") { fast_version(' there') } x.compare! end end test ``` results: ```ruby master_version {:FREE=>-1981, :T_STRING=>2052} master_version with arg {:FREE=>-1001, :T_STRING=>1000} fast_version {:FREE=>-1001, :T_STRING=>1000} fast_version with arg {:FREE=>-1001, :T_STRING=>1000} Warming up -------------------------------------- master_version 138.851k i/100ms master_version with arg 164.029k i/100ms fast_version 165.737k i/100ms fast_version with arg 167.016k i/100ms Calculating ------------------------------------- master_version 2.464M (±14.7%) i/s - 11.941M in 5.023307s master_version with arg 3.754M (± 8.5%) i/s - 18.699M in 5.021354s fast_version 3.449M (±11.7%) i/s - 17.071M in 5.033312s fast_version with arg 3.636M (± 6.9%) i/s - 18.205M in 5.034792s Comparison: master_version with arg: 3753896.1 i/s fast_version with arg: 3636094.5 i/s - same-ish: difference falls within error fast_version: 3448766.2 i/s - same-ish: difference falls within error master_version: 2463857.3 i/s - 1.52x slower ```

| * | Fix connection handling with three-tier configeileencodes2018-03-163-1/+52
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| If you had a three-tier config, the `establish_connection` that's called in the Railtie on load can't figure out how to access the default configuration. This is because Rails assumes that the config is the first value in the hash and always associated with the key from the environment. With a three tier config however we need to go one level deeper. This commit includes 2 changes. 1) removes a line from `resolve_all` which was parsing out the the environment from the config so instead of getting ``` { :development => { :primary => { :database => "whatever" } }, :animals => { :database => "whatever-animals" } }, etc with test / prod } ``` We'd instead end up with a config that had no attachment to it's envioronment. ``` { :primary => { :database => "whatever" } :animals => { :database => "whatever-animals" } etc - without test and prod } ``` Not only did this mean that Active Record didn't know how to establish a connection, it didn't have the other necessary configs along with it in the configs list. So fix this I removed the line that deletes these configs. The second thing this commit changes is adding this line to `establish_connection` ``` spec = spec[spec_name.to_sym] if spec[spec_name.to_sym] ``` When you have a three-tier config and don't pass any hash/symbol/env etc to `establish_connection` the resolver will automatically return both the primary and secondary (in this case animals db) configurations. We'll get an `database configuration does not specify adapter` error because AR will try to establish a connection on the `primary` key rather than the `primary` key's config. It assumes that the `development` or default env automatically will return a config hash, but with a three-tier config we actually get a key and config `primary => config`. This fix is a bit of a bandaid because it's not the "correct" way to handle this situation, but it does solve our immediate problem. The new code here is saying "if the config returned from the resolver (I know it's called spec in here but we interchange our meanings a LOT and what is returned is a three-tier config) has a key matching the "primary" spec name, grab the config from the spec and pass that to the estalbish_connection method". This works because if we pass `:animals` or a hash, or `:primary` we'll already have the correct configuration to connect with. This fixes the case where we want Rail to connect with the default connection. Coming soon is a refactoring that should eliminate the need to do this but I need this fix in order to write the multi-db rake tasks that I promised in my RailsConf submission. `@tenderlove` and I are working on the refactoring of the internals for connection management but it won't be ready for a few weeks and this issue has been blocking progress.

| * | | | Ensure that leading date is stripped by quoted_timeAndrew White2018-03-112-4/+37
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| In #24542, quoted_time was introduced to strip the leading date component for time columns because it was having a significant effect in mariadb. However, it assumed that the date component was always 2000-01-01 which isn't the case, especially if the source wasn't another time column.
